&lt;p&gt;&lt;b&gt;Nouvelle page&lt;/b&gt;&lt;/p&gt;&lt;div&gt;The LMDZ source Fortran code is located under the libf directory of the root LMDZ directory.&lt;br /&gt;
&lt;br /&gt;
The various directories (and their respective subdirectories) are there to &lt;br /&gt;
separate codes with various functionalities. The main driver in this&lt;br /&gt;
organization is to cleanly separate dynamics, physics and their&lt;br /&gt;
interface. In practice:&lt;br /&gt;
&lt;br /&gt;
== dynamics solver related subdirectories ==&lt;br /&gt;
&lt;br /&gt;
'''dyn3d'''     : dynamics, serial version&lt;br /&gt;
  &lt;br /&gt;
'''dyn3dpar'''  : dynamics, parallel version. Obsolete (many arrays remained global requiring more overall memory with increasing core number)&lt;br /&gt;
&lt;br /&gt;
'''dyn3dmem'''  : dynamics, parallel (optimized) version with improved memory management (all arrays are local to each core)&lt;br /&gt;
&lt;br /&gt;
'''dyn3d_common''' : routines used by all dynamics (serial or parallel)&lt;br /&gt;
&lt;br /&gt;
'''filtre''' : high-latitude longitudinal filter for lonxlat grid (used by the dynamics, serial or parallel)&lt;br /&gt;
&lt;br /&gt;
'''grid''' : routine for model's grid generation (used by the dynamics, serial or parallel)&lt;br /&gt;
&lt;br /&gt;
== physics packages related subdirectories ==&lt;br /&gt;
&lt;br /&gt;
'''phy*''' : various physics packages:&lt;br /&gt;
&lt;br /&gt;
- phylmd: standard terrestrial lmd physics&lt;br /&gt;
&lt;br /&gt;
- phylmdiso: version with isotopes (temporary, should be merged in phylmd)&lt;br /&gt;
&lt;br /&gt;
- phymar: physics of the 'modele atmospherique regional', obsolete&lt;br /&gt;
&lt;br /&gt;
- phydev: 'physics that does nothing but does it well'&lt;br /&gt;
&lt;br /&gt;
'''phy_common''' : common routines to all physics (different modules for parallelism, abort_physics, geometry, getin wrapper, ...)&lt;br /&gt;
&lt;br /&gt;
== physics-dynamics interface ==&lt;br /&gt;
&lt;br /&gt;
'''dynphy_lonlat''': contains the dynamics/physics interface with at a first level common routines to all physics and dedicated specific routines for each physics (e.g., call physics + physics initialization) in a subdirectory of the same name as the physics package's (phylmd, phydev, ...).&lt;br /&gt;
In addition the subdirectory stores main programs, other than the gcm, which require access to both physics and dynamics routines (e.g. to generate initial states, such as ce0l).&lt;br /&gt;
Note that if a physics package name is an extension of an already existing physics package (e.g. phylmdiso and phylmd) then they share the same interface (phylmd here).  &lt;br /&gt;
&lt;br /&gt;
'''phy*/dyn1d''': the 1D model (and links to some required dyn3d/* routines)  &lt;br /&gt;
&lt;br /&gt;
== others ==&lt;br /&gt;
&lt;br /&gt;
'''misc''': (misceallenous) dynamics and physics independent routines which can be used by either but rely on neither (e.g. random number generator, tridiagonal matrix solver, NetCDF function wrappers, CRAY-specific routines, ...)&lt;br /&gt;
&lt;br /&gt;
obsolete: obsolete code not used anymore but moved and stored here for an easy quick look.&lt;br /&gt;
